And David girded his sword over his armor, and he tried in vain to go, for he was not used to them. Then David said to Saul, "I cannot go with these; for I am not used to them." And David put them off.
40
Then he took his staff in his hand, and chose five smooth stones from the brook, and put them in his shepherd's bag or wallet; his sling was in his hand, and he drew near to the Philistine.
41
And the Philistine came on and drew near to David, with his shield-bearer in front of him.
42
And when the Philistine looked, and saw David, he disdained him; for he was but a youth, ruddy and comely in appearance.
43
And the Philistine said to David, "Am I a dog, that you come to me with sticks?" And the Philistine cursed David by his gods.
